Local candidates who are running for St. Joseph County Sheriff were invited to make a statement at a public forum hosted by the American Democracy Project and the League of Women Voters.
We have a statement from incumbent Bill Redman, a democrat, who is running unopposed in the primary.
Forum organizers extended the invitation to Republican candidate Kevin McGowan. McGowan did not participate.
Indiana’s primary election is May 3.
